About this Head of Marketing role at Mach9

Mach9 · Onsite · San Francisco

The role:

At Mach9, the Head of Marketing will build the company’s first complete marketing system and define a new category in the infrastructure industry. We have a proven product, customers who rely on it, and a growing team; what we need now is a repeatable way to turn that momentum into market leadership.

This role is ideal for a marketing leader who knows how to step into a company at an inflection point and turn a deeply technical product into a clear market narrative—and turn that narrative into measurable pipeline.

You’ll evolve Mach9’s story from a product for surveyors into a broader platform for infrastructure work, establish marketing as a core driver of revenue growth, and make Mach9 impossible to ignore.

Where you will make an impact:

  • Define Mach9’s positioning, messaging, and category narrative across industries, customers, and top talent

  • Build a repeatable demand-generation system, identifying the channels and programs that drive qualified pipeline, demo requests, product sign-ups, usage, and expansion opportunities

  • Establish clear attribution and reporting, then own a quarterly marketing-sourced pipeline target alongside sales

  • Lead product marketing across launches, customer proof, and sales enablement

  • Build Mach9’s industry presence through events, partnerships, press, founder visibility, and customer advocacy

  • Lead and mentor a small in-house team, using AI, agencies, contractors, and creative partners to extend its reach

  • Partner closely with product and engineering to translate technical breakthroughs and features into compelling proof for our customers

What you bring:

  • 5+ years of marketing leadership experience (Director-level) at a fast-scaling tech company (Series A–C or equivalent growth stage)

  • Hands-on experience leading marketing for technical products (developer tools, generative AI), with content or campaigns tailored to technical and non-technical audiences.

  • Exceptional strength in product, content, and revenue marketing

  • Experience defining and instrumenting marketing measurement from the ground up, including pipeline attribution, funnel conversion, and channel ROI

  • Exceptional writing and editorial judgment across product messaging, campaigns, executive communications, and long-form content

  • Strong leadership + management skills and the ability to develop a small team while remaining personally involved in the work

  • Technical curiosity and a genuine interest in becoming a credible subject-matter expert alongside engineers, product leaders, and specialized customers

  • Expert at using AI to increase the quality and output of a lean marketing team.

Bonus experience (not required):

  • Prior work in geospatial, construction technology, robotics, industrial software, CAD, GIS, or infrastructure

  • Experience selling through channel partners, resellers, associations, or industry events

  • Experience building an engaged community program from the ground up
